Life sciences Life sciences University of Bern study provides insights into potential Sars-Cov-2 treatments 29 July 2020
Life sciences EPFL spin-off Artiria Medical raises CHF 3 million to improve stroke treatment 15 July 2020
Life sciences Life sciences Debiopharm and Takeda collaborate on the development of therapies for gastrointestinal disorders 16 June 2020